Philosophy

The philosophy of our vine cultivation and wine making process is to follows time-honored traditions and doing things the old-fashioned way. Out of respect for Mother Nature and with the intention of offering wines of exceptional quality, we don’t use herbicides and other harmful chemicals. Because our grapes are handpicked and the way they are processed in the cellar, we are proud to offer you excellent wines, the way nature intended them to be.

Location: Gmajna
Wine region: Vipava Valley
Grape varieties: Cabernet Sauvignjon, Merlot
Soil composition: flysch
Trellis system: single Guyot
Elevation: 111m above sea level
Geographical position: top of the hill, non-terraced
Year of planting: 2004
Harvesting: handpicked, carefully selected grapes
